PROT Price Targets Summary
Protector Forsikring ASA
According to Wall Street analysts, the average 1-year price target for
PROT is 598.4 NOK with a low forecast of 565.6 NOK and a high forecast of 630 NOK.

What is the Revenue forecast for Protector Forsikring ASA?
Projected CAGR
8%
Over the last 9 years, the compound annual growth rate for Revenue has been 18%. The projected CAGR for the next 3 years is 8%.
What is the Net Income forecast for Protector Forsikring ASA?
Projected CAGR
-1%
Over the last 9 years, the compound annual growth rate for Net Income has been 22%. The projected CAGR for the next 3 years is -1%.
